NAS CSI driver for k8s clusters running on nifcloud
- Create nifcloud NASInstances triggered by PVCs creation.
- Shared NASInstance for multiple PVCs with source path provisioning
- Auto configure node private IPs, zone, networkID and recommended CIDR block for NASInstances.
- NAS private IP selected from CIDR block of storageclass parameter or PVC annotation.
- Authorize/Revoke node private IPs onto NASSecurityGroup (Node private IPs kept on CSINode annotation).
- Delete NASInstances on deletion of the PVC

- Numbers and booleans must set as strings
param | example | ||
---|---|---|---|
zone | Nifcloud zone | east-11 | Required |
instanceType | Nifcloud NAS InstanceType 0/1 | "0" | Required |
networkId | Private network ID | net-0123abcd net-COMMON_PRIVATE |
Required |
reservedIpv4Cidr | IP range NASInstance can use, ignored when PVC annotation reservedIPv4Cidr is set | 192.168.10.64/29 | Optional |
capacityParInstanceGiB | Capacity of a Shared NASInstance | "500" | Required when shared="true" |
shared | Multi PVs shared a NASInstance with source path provisioning | "true" | Optional |
4 storageclasses installed on starting CSI controller
name | instanceType | shared |
---|---|---|
csi-nifcloud-nas-std | "0" | not set ("false") |
csi-nifcloud-nas-hi | "1" | not set ("false") |
csi-nifcloud-nas-shrd | "0" | "true" |
csi-nifcloud-nas-shrdhi | "1" | "true" |

- Share a NASInstance for multi PVCs by setting Storageclass parameter shared=true.
- For the first PVC create a NASInstance, and for second and after provision instantly by making source pathes on the shared NASInstance.
- Create another shared NASInstance when requested resource sum of PVCs exceeds its capacity.
- Delete shared NASInstance when all PVCs deleted.
annotation(nas.csi.storage.nifcloud.com) | example | default | |
---|---|---|---|
reservedIPv4Cidr | IP or IP range for NAS Instance | 172.16.10.128 192.168.0.64/27 | StorageClass' reservedIPv4Cidr |
permission | Initial permission of mounted directory | "777" | "755" |
